Turnip and Mustard Greens
Disease Control
Damping-Off (Pythium and Phytophthora)
Apply the following preplant incorporated or as a soil-surface spray after planting.
Ridomil Gold-- 1-2 pt 4E/A (turnip greens only)
Downy Mildew
Apply the following during periods of high moisture and moderate temperatures and continue every 14 days.
Forum--6 oz 4.18SC/A plus fixed copper, or
Aliette--3 lb 8OWDG/A (for mustard greens only)
Leaf Spot
Practice crop rotation with crops other that crucifers. When conditions favor disease development, alternate the following every 7 to 10 days.
azoxystrobin (Quadris--6.2 - 15.4 oz 2.08F/A or Amistar--2-5 oz 80WDG/A, or
copper, fixed--0.75-1.5 lb 53.8DF/A or OLF
